At Colonel Sam Smith Park in Toronto, between 9:30 and 11:00 am, a single immature male Harlequin Duck was seen in the eastern bay associating and diving with a group of Buffleheads.
Next, the Western Grebe was seen diving in the unfrozen part of the marina, at very close range. Also in the marina was a (presumably female) Snowy Owl sitting on the ice around the docks. Other noteworthy sightings were a singing Northern Shrike and a Horned Grebe. Directions as per previous post.
